How Do We Open a Locked Trunk?

Two methods depending on the situation. If your keys are inside the trunk, we open the car door first (same as a standard lockout) and pop the trunk using the interior release button or lever. If the trunk lock cylinder itself is stuck or jammed, we pick it directly.

Most modern cars have electronic trunk releases accessible from the driver's seat or the key fob. We can also access the trunk through the rear seat pass-through on many sedans if the release mechanism has failed.

What If the Trunk Release Doesn't Work?

We pick the trunk lock cylinder or bypass the release mechanism. Older vehicles have a keyed trunk lock that we can pick with standard automotive tools. Newer vehicles with purely electronic releases might need the rear seat folded down to access the trunk from inside the cabin.

We've opened trunks on everything from 1990s Buicks to brand new Teslas. Different approach for each, but we get the trunk open.
